Blue-Black C - 44
For Copper
 

Tri blue C-44 is a concentrated liquid for producing blue-black color tones on solid or plated Copper, Brass & Bronze at room temperature. Tri blue C-44 is used primarily for decorative purposes to produce a blue-black color finish.

OPERATING CONDITIONS
Concentration: 1 part Tri blue C-44 to 2 parts of water.
Temperature: 65º - 75º F.
Time: 10 - 60 seconds.
Tank: Acid resistant containers (plastic, P.V.C. or Polyethylene).

Color Formation:

Color formation is depended upon time of immersion and concentration of solution. For a dark black finish, dilute the solution with 1 part of water and the immersion time should be 10-60 seconds depending on the desired color.

Surface Preparation:

  • Clean the part with Cleaner 104 (1 part of Cleaner 104 to 2 parts of water).
  • Rinse with overflowing cold water.
  • Immerse pieces in Tri blue C-44 solution for 10 to 60 seconds. Agitate the parts to break air bubbles and to assure solution contact with all surfaces. Plastic baskets should be used for small pieces.
  • Rinse thoroughly with over flowing cold water, to stop chemical reaction.
  • It is recommended that a protective lacquer Trilac 747 or WSL-55 (clear or black, water-soluble) be applied to the coating to provide maximum life. Parts can be immersed in a water-soluble lacquer while still wet from the preceding rinse, or can be sealed.

Bath Maintenance:

Since blackening with Tri blue C-44 is a chemical reaction between the solution and metal surface, the chemical activity will diminish as the solution is used. When the time required to produce the desired color increases, add 5% by volume of Tri blue C-44 liquid concentrate.

Caution:

The Tri blue C-44 is a mildly acidic solution. Avoid contact with the skin or eyes. Protective clothing, gloves, and a face shield should be worn when operating. In case of contact, flush skin or eyes with plenty of water. For eyes, call a physician. Tri blue C-44 liquid is poisonous; do not take internally!
